Subject(s): Genre/Form: Summary: "Depression is more than feeling sad sometimes. For Bindu, depression can make it hard to get out of bed in the morning or focus at school. Even working on an exciting design project can be difficult, with emotions that go up and down. But with treatment, Bindu is learning how to feel better. Find out how she copes with her mood disorder, with help from her support system, and discovers life beyond depression."-- Provided by publisher.

A beautifully illustrated, adventure-filled graphic novel that provides a kid's-eye view of living with depression.

Author and illustrator Hey Gee tells the story of a real-life Mayo Clinic patient. Through a first-person narrative, this book gives a glimpse into the daily routine, challenges and coping techniques of a child managing depression. Color and visual techniques bring the emotional ups and downs to life for a powerful impact. A beautifully illustrated graphic nonfiction approach provides a kid's-eye view of living with, and beyond, this common mental health condition.
